The Don Gaspar Inn is in a quiet location in a residential neighborhood just 2 blocks from the state capitol building in Santa Fe. It's an easy walk to the plaza and most of the sights/restaurants and acitivities you'll likely want to see. ..good because you don't want the hassle of finding street parking in Santa Fe! Visiting Santa Fe for hiking and the opera, we enjoyed two nights in this charming inn. Although easy to find when driving, Don Gaspar is tucked away on a residential street about eight blocks from the plaza. The room was lovely, breakfasts in the garden tasty and the staff ultra-knowledgable of Santa Fe and helpful without hovering. We'll visit again. more

Look no further than the Don Gasper Inn. Soft comfortable king-size bed, warm fireplace, bathrobes, whirlpool tub, radiant-floor heating in the bath. Service is excellent, also; friendly faces serve delicious, hot breakfasts. Walking distance to Plaza (If you're so inclined), but strongly suggest spending your time on Canyon Road. Overall, a relaxing, wonderful visit. more
